    What makes some things confusing is when traffic is coming from the opposite direction. I was before I retired as safety officer for one of the world's largest trucking companie. One of my responsibilities is knowing what the laws are in my state. The biggest thing that most of the drivers did not know about was school buses. Now we are talking about men and women who have commercial driver's license and in some cases 20-30 years of experience. When I would throw up a picture and ask what traffic would have to stop for school bus with its red lights on everyone new behind the bus had to stop. They all knew if there was one lane going one way and one lane going the other way that you would have to stop coming in the opposite direction. Where I started losing most people is when you show a four-lane highway similar to this one in the story. I would have to say at least a good 80% of the people that I was reviewing safety with did not know that they had to stop coming the opposite way. The one big difference is if there's a divider in the road then traffic coming the opposite way does not need to stop.
    I think one of the best things out there is when the news gets involved and can educate people on what the rules of the road are in their area. I always told the drivers when in doubt stop and wait.
